My husband, two girls (ages 10 and 6) and I vacation at the Marriott Grande Hotel in Mobile Bay Alabama several weekends each summer. Even though it is a quick 2 1/2 hours away from where we live in New Orleans, I would drive further to get there.
more +From the moment you drive onto the grounds, one can't help but notice the exquisite landscaping with wild flowers dotting the grounds. There are several buildings to choose from but my husband and I choose the Bay building as it is steps away from the beach.
There is no other resort that is as family friendly. The pool is a graduated one so that moms of the youngest kids can let their kids sit at the most shallow part of the pool without worry. The pool is quite large with ground sprayers, waterfalls and a corkscrew slide with no age restrictions. There are lifeguards at all times. The lounge chairs are plentiful and covered by umbrellas. The have a poolside restaurant and bar. Steps away from the pool is the bay which serves the same function as a beach. Free bike rentals for singles (or for families of four) can be taken for a lovely ride down past the property and back. They have canoes and other motorized water gear as well.
There is a tetherball game and volleyball court as well as shoe horns amidst the hammocks and rocking chairs.
Each day, the resort has scheduled activities free of charge for kids of all ages executed by their friendly, young staff. They have a shell hunt on their beach at 9:30 followed by arts and crafts under a large shade tree on a picnic table followed by tattoos and popsicles at 3:30 poolside.
Each day at 4:00, the lobby offers tea, coffee, scones and cookies, once again, free of charge.
They have a large playground when the kids get tired of swimming and a hot tub which welcomes all ages.
There is an adult only pool and hot tub as well.
In the evening there are traditional activities such as the S'mores bonfire each Friday night at 8:30 and Saturday is a dive in movie on a large screen by the pool.
The gym is impressive and there is an indoor pool if needed as well.
The grounds are gorgeous and the pond in the center of the grounds is full of hungry ducks that will eat out of your hands. The front desk will furnish all the duck food you want.
The restaurants are fabulous but what stands out is the Sunday Jazz Brunch.
There is no reason to leave the grounds once you arrive. My family and I have had lovely weekends with wonderful memories. The rate might be high at times, but you do not get nickle and dimed after you arrive. I give this hotel my highest recommendation.
